Top Definition
A person who is smart, funny, and beautiful. Erica is very freindly and gets along with ANYONE. It's amazing!!! She can always make a person smile, even when they're in the darkest of moods. I would not be complete without my Erica. She puts the sun in my sunshine, and puts butterflies in my belly when she speaks. Erica is the most amazing girl I've ever met. If you dont meet her, your missing out on the greatest person on the face of the earth... or any other planet for that matter.
Guy1- Dude, did you see that girl? I was too speechless to catch her name. :(

Guy2-Thats got to be OpalCandace!
by brunette2011 February 03, 2010
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.